Neglecting Correct Surface Area Preparation



When repainting your interiors, neglecting appropriate surface area preparation can bring about unsuitable results and decrease the long life of the paint job. Among one of the most important steps in attaining a professional-looking finish is ensuring that the surfaces to be painted are tidy, smooth, and effectively primed.

Overlooking to clean the walls completely prior to painting can result in bond problems, where the paint falls short to appropriately stay with the surface. Dust, dirt, and oil can prevent the paint from sticking uniformly, resulting in peeling or flaking in time.

Additionally, falling short to address imperfections such as splits, openings, or uneven appearances can cause the imperfections to reveal through the paint, diminishing the overall appearance of the room.

Properly priming the surface areas before painting is likewise necessary, as it helps the paint stick much better, advertises also insurance coverage, and can avoid stains or discoloration from bleeding with.

Putting in the time to prepare the surface areas sufficiently will inevitably make sure a specialist and durable paint work.

Rushing With the Paint Refine



Quickly progressing through the painting process can compromise the top quality and sturdiness of the result. Rushing can bring about a number of issues, such as unequal coverage, visible brush strokes, paint drips, and missed areas. Each of these issues detracts from the overall aesthetic allure of the room and can be lengthy to correct.
